Rocscience Slide 7.0 is a professional 2D limit equilibrium software used for evaluating the stability of soil and rock slopes, embankments, and earth dams. While version 7.0 was a significant release, the program has since evolved into Slide2 to reflect its 2D capabilities and differentiate it from the 3D version, Slide3. Key Features of Slide 7.0
